Handyman License Requirements in Wichita Falls, TX

Texas does not issue a general “handyman” or “general contractor” license for basic repair/remodel work, but Texas DOES require state trade licenses for plumbing, electrical, HVAC, and fire sprinkler work. In Wichita Falls (Wichita County), you should expect city-level registration/permits for building-related work and state-level licensing for any regulated trade; even when no state contractor license is required, permits may still be required for many jobs.

Permit vs. Contractor License — The Legal Difference

A license is your legal authorization (usually state-issued for trades like plumbing/electrical/HVAC) to perform regulated work. A permit is job-specific approval (usually city-issued) to perform certain construction at a specific address and it triggers inspections. You can be “license-exempt” as a handyman but still need permits for many projects, and you cannot use a permit to bypass state trade licensing.

Legal Registration Steps for Wichita Falls

Follow these steps to operate legally as a handyman in Wichita Falls, Texas:

  1. Step 1: Form your business (LLC optional) and get an EIN; Texas LLC filing fee is $300.
  2. Step 2: Contact Wichita Falls Building Inspections/Permits to ask what contractor registration is required for ‘handyman/home repair’ and the exact annual fee and categories; register before pulling permits.
  3. Step 3: If you will touch plumbing/electrical/HVAC, pursue the appropriate Texas state trade license path (or subcontract to licensed trades).
  4. Step 4: Get general liability insurance and keep certificates ready for customers, property managers, and any on-base/federal work.
